Sobre los servicios de mapas de resultado en aplicaciones REST
La salida de geoprocesamiento típica de un servicio REST es una representación JSON. Los clientes interpretan la JSON y definen la simbología en consecuencia. Sin embargo, si el servicio se ha publicado con un servicio de mapas de resultado, la opción de servidor de geoprocesamiento crea un servicio de mapas con representación visual de salidas. El servicio de mapas de resultado se puede agregar a mapas web y aplicaciones Web.
¿Cómo se publica un servicio de geoprocesamiento con una opción servicio de mapas de resultado?
La opción Ver resultados con un servicio de mapas está habilitada cuando publica un servicio de geoprocesamiento. También puede habilitar esta opción para un servicio publicado al editar la propiedad del servicio de geoprocesamiento mediante el Administrador de ArcGIS 10.1 for Server o ArcGIS for Desktop.
Más información sobre las propiedades del servicio de geoprocesamiento
¿Qué son las capas en un servicio de mapas de resultado?
Un servicio de mapas de resultado crea una capa para cada parámetro de salida. El orden de las capas se corresponderá con el orden de los parámetros de salida, tal y como se define en la descripción de la tarea de geoprocesamiento.
¿Un servicio de mapas de resultado contiene capas para todos los parámetros de salida?
Un servicio de mapas de resultado contendrá una capa para todos los parámetros de salida del geodataset, como GPFeatureRecordsetLayer, GPRasterDataLayer y GPRecordSet. Las salidas escalares, como GPDate, GPDouble, GPLong, GPBoolean, GPDataFile y GPLinearUnit no se puede representar como una capa de mapa y no serán devueltas para estos parámetros.
Los tipo de datos de parámetros de salida de GPString son un caso especial. Las salidas de geoprocesamiento de GPString pueden ser escalares o puede una referencia a un geodataset como TIN, capa de CAD o capa de estadísticas geográficas. Si la salida es una referencia a geodataset, el servicio de mapas de resultado contendrá una capa.
¿De dónde procede está la simbología de las capas del servicio de mapas?
La simbología de las capas se basa en la simbología definida por el autor del servicio.
Más información acerca de definir la simbología de salida para las tareas de geoprocesamiento
¿Cómo se puede acceder a los servicios de mapas de resultado y capas?
Un servicio de mapas de resultado se crea para cada trabajo asíncrono satisfactorio. Un trabajo de geoprocesamiento asíncrono se identifica mediante un único jobId. A un servicio de mapas de resultado se accede mediante el jobID, como se muestra a continuación:
http://<arcgis rest services>/<GPServiceName>/MapServer/jobs/<jobID>
A las capas en un servicio de mapas de resultado se accede de forma similar a las capas de servicio de mapas basándose en el orden de las capas.
http://<arcgis rest services>/<GPServiceName>/MapServer/jobs/<jobID>/0 http://<arcgis rest services>/<GPServiceName>/MapServer/jobs/<jobID>/1
¿Cuáles son las operaciones y funcionalidades compatibles?
El servicio de mapas de resultado es un servicio de mapas dinámico y admite todas las operaciones y recursos hijo de un servicio de mapas dinámico típico:
Operaciones del servicio de mapas:
Recursos secundarios:
Un servicio de mapas de resultado también es consciente del tiempo y admite la consulta y la exportación de mapas basándose en el tiempo.
¿Cómo se agrega un servicio de mapas de resultado en aplicaciones Web?
Puede utilizar el jobId y agregar el servicio de mapas de resultado como una capa de servicio de mapas dinámica en aplicaciones web. También puede acceder a las capas de entidades en un servicio de mapas de resultado de forma independiente y agregarlas como capas de entidades en el mapa web.
Más información acerca del uso del servicio de mapas de resultado en aplicaciones Web
¿Cuál es la duración de los servicios de mapas de resultado?
El ciclo de vida de los servicios de mapas de resultado se determina por la propiedad Antigüedad máxima del archivo del directorio arcgisjobs. El valor predeterminado es 360 minutos, pero se puede modificar al administrador del servidor a través del Administrador de ArcGIS 10.1 for Server o ArcGIS for Desktop. La siguiente ilustración muestra el cuadro de diálogo Directorio de edición en el Administrador de ArcGIS 10.1 for Server y la configuración del directorio arcgisjobs, incluida la Antigüedad máxima del archivo.
La propiedad de la antigüedad máxima del archivo se aplica a todos los trabajos asíncronos y a los servicios de mapas de resultado asociados en el directorio arcgisjobs. La modificación afectará a todos los puestos de trabajo y los servicios de mapas de resultado creados en el directorio arcgisjobs.